Laptop Battery Draining Overnight on Windows 11? Here's How to Fix It
Is your portable computer accumulator discharging noticeably overnight on Windows 11? It's a frequent issue for many users, but thankfully, there are several steps you can use to correct it. Let's examine some potential reasons and simple troubleshooting approaches. First, verify your power settings - ensure you're using a power-saving plan and that your display isn't set to an excessively high setting. Next, scan the activity in Task Manager (Ctrl+Shift+Esc) to identify any programs that might be consuming excessive power. You can also turn off background programs that you don't need. Consider updating your firmware, Practical and easy to use particularly your video drivers. Finally, reset your battery according to your notebook's manufacturer's instructions. Here's a quick rundown:
- Review Power Settings
- Inspect Background Programs
- Install Drivers
- Calibrate the Battery
By implementing these tips, you should be able to boost your portable computer's battery life and avoid overnight depletion.
Windows 11 Modern Sleep Difficulties: Fixing & Remedies
Many people are encountering unexpected behavior with Windows 11's Modern Standby feature. These hurdles often manifest as slow wake times, significant battery usage during sleep, or even utter failure to transition into the resting state. Several causes could be at fault , including outdated drivers , background applications , and problematic hardware. To resolve these situations , consider the following:
- Update your firmware, particularly your chipset and graphics drivers .
- Disable unnecessary background processes that might be hindering proper sleep .
- Examine your power configurations to ensure they are set for Modern Hibernation.
- Perform the System troubleshooter to pinpoint potential issues .
- Briefly deactivate fast boot to see if it's contributing the problem .
- Evaluate a complete boot to exclude driver incompatibilities .
Resolving these potential factors should assist you to enjoy a more consistent Windows 11 standby experience .
Troubleshooting Rapid Portable Energy Depletion in Windows 11
Is your Windows 11 laptop battery draining more rapidly than usual ? Several elements could be leading to this situation. Begin by examining the battery report in Windows – search for “ energy report” in the start menu to view which programs are using the highest power . End any redundant programs running in the operating system. Also, ensure that your software , particularly your video program, are current . Finally, consider modifying your energy options to a optimized battery saver setting .
